How long does IRB review take?
The amount of time that IRB review requires depends of a number of things, including but not limited to, the completeness of the initial submission to the complexity of the issues involves. Generally, a protocol submitted for full board review will receive an administrative review within two days of the deadline. Completed IRB applications submitted by the deadline for full-board review are placed on that month’s agenda.
